What does the Flag: Lithuania emoji mean?

The Flag: Lithuania emoji (๐Ÿ‡ฑ๐Ÿ‡น) comes from the Flags set and represents flag: lithuania. It is used to add visual context and emotional nuance where plain text alone would feel flat. Its official Unicode assignment is U+1F1F1 U+1F1F9, introduced with Emoji 1.0 in 2015. Once your system has an updated emoji font, the character renders consistently wherever you paste it. People use this flag to cheer for a team, tag a destination, indicate language, or show pride in a place that matters to them. On Apple, Google, Samsung, Microsoft and other vendors the artwork differs slightly โ€” colour palette, shading, and line weight change โ€” but the core concept of flag: lithuania stays identical, so the emoji remains universally readable. You can copy this emoji as the character itself (๐Ÿ‡ฑ๐Ÿ‡น), as an HTML entity (🇱🇹), or as a shortcode (:flagand-lithuania:) for platforms like Slack, Discord, and GitHub.
